Project Summary
Tetra Tech is providing energy expertise and related technical and material assistance to the Government of Ukraine. This project focuses on enhancing the resilience, reliability, affordability, and security of the electricity, natural gas, and district heating sectors. The scope of work includes addressing immediate challenges and physical damage to energy infrastructure, as well as preparing for Ukraine's post-war reconstruction and long-term energy security.
Position Summary
Tetra Tech seeks a Project Analyst—Municipal Infrastructure to identify, develop, and implement activities supporting modernization projects in the municipal infrastructure sector, with a focus on district heating as well as water supply and sanitation. The Analyst will liaise with municipal utilities, local self-government authorities, and international financial institutions to improve investment planning, financial sustainability, and project bankability in line with the Ukraine Facility, Public Investment Management, and broader national goals. This position will report to the Deputy Municipal Lead. This is a full-time position for Ukrainian citizens for the duration of the program (until April 2029), to be based in the Kyiv office. Occasional travel around Ukraine may be required.
Position Responsibilities
- Collect, analyze, and interpret quantitative and qualitative data from municipalities and utilities related to energy efficiency modernization projects in the district heating sector and the water supply and sanitation sector
Review project proposals and feasibility assessments from the DREAM platform, the Single Project Pipeline of public investment, international financial institutions' programs, and state or local initiatives to assess project bankability, identify investment opportunities, and determine potential program support
Prepare analytical notes, project summaries, and presentations for the team, management, and stakeholders to justify activity prioritization and resource allocation
Coordinate with technical and economic experts to integrate feasibility considerations into project analyses and design at early stages
Work closely with Deputy Municipal Lead and Component 2 Lead on implementing and monitoring activities for municipal utilities
Communicate and liaise with stakeholders; participate in project meetings and sub-component progress reviews
